Anton Dietz – who was born in Innsbruck – is an Austrian Righteous Among the Nations. On January 18, 1945 there was an order to bring all inmates of the prison of Innsbruck to the concentration camp Bergen-Belsen. Five female Jews were planning to escape the prison. The two inspectors Karl Dickbauer and Anton Dietz supported them. Only two could manage to flee.
